Pete Dye is Struggling with Alzheimer’s

One of only four golf course architects enshrined in the World Golf Hall of Fame, Pete Dye is struggling with Alzheimer’s Disease. Marathon Classic announces Dates and Charities for 2018 Tournament

The Marathon Classic will host its annual LPGA Tour event July 9-15 at Highland Meadows Golf Club in Sylvania. The lady professionals will be vying for a piece of $1.6 million total purse, with the winner banking $250,000. 2017 Marathon Classic Donates Proceeds

The 2017 Marathon Classic wrote checks to 23 area children’s charities totaling $523,000. Since the first Jamie Farr Toledo Classic was held in 1984, the annual women’s golf tournament has generated over $9.8 million and distributed those funds to 170 area children’s charities.
